Description
Chambers attracts a significant volume of junior advocacy work and prides itself on developing pupils and junior tenants, helping them become strong advocates capable of a sustained career at the bar. 


Pupil Supervisors
Pupils will likely be supervised by one or both Heads of Chambers. Criminal pupillage will cover both Defence and Prosecution work up to RASSO Grade 4 level. Civil pupillage will also cover all civil hearings up to Multi-Track Trials.

Pupils will share their supervisor’s room and accompany them in all aspects of their practice. You may, from time to time, also work with other Members of Chambers covering Magistrates Courts work if warranted by your development.


First Six
You will go to court and attend conferences on a daily basis with your pupil supervisor. You will also assist with undertaking drafting and written advices as well as legal research.


Second Six
You will take on an increasing amount of your own work and as the tenancy decision approaches are likely to be in court a minimum of three of four times per week.


Award
Chambers guarantees income of a minimum of £25,000, comprising of a £8,400 award during the first six and guaranteed earnings of £16,600 in the second six. However, past pupils have exceeded these figures in their second six, earning over and above the guaranteed minimum. We estimate pupils will earn £20,000-£35,000 in their second six, making the total anticipated earnings £28,400 – £43,400 during pupillage.
